Music Theory

How music is built: notes, intervals, scales, chords, keys, and rhythm, and why any of it sounds the way it does.

01

Notes and pitch

Where pitch comes from, why the octave sounds like the same note again, and how twelve semitones divide it.

02

Intervals

The distance between two notes, why some pairs sound sweet and others tense, and the simple ratios behind it.

03

Scales

Choosing seven notes from twelve, the pattern that makes the major scale, and why minor sounds different.

04

Chords

Stacking thirds into triads, the four basic qualities, and how sevenths add colour and push a progression forward.

05

Keys

How a piece commits to a scale, what key signatures record, and the circle of fifths that maps them all.

06

Rhythm

Beat, tempo, and metre, how note values divide time, and why syncopation makes music move.
